We’re launching SWAB CAB, a mobile testing program which will do mass surveillance testing in communities where transmission is very high. Pilot area is Malabon. Thank you to LGU Malabon, Ube Express and Kaya Natin Movement for the partnership.
The Office of VP @lenirobredo bought 411,480 personal protective equipment (PPEs) for 29,432 health frontline workers all over the country after raising P61.8 million worth of funds.
